Has Reporting on Physical Therapy Interventions Improved in 2 Decades? An Analysis of 140 Trials Reporting on 225 Interventions. McCambridge AB, Nasser AM, Mehta P, Stubbs PW, Verhagen AP. JOSPT. 2021;51:503-509. doi:10.2519/jospt.2021.10642 Due to copyright laws, unless the article is open source we cannot legally post the PDF on the website for the world to download at will. PT Inquest is an online journal club. Hosted by Erik Meira and JW Matheson, the show looks at an article every week and discusses how they apply to current physical therapy practice.
